#557271 Hex Color Code

#557271

The Hexadecimal Color #557271 is a contrast shade of Dim Gray. #557271 RGB value is rgb(85, 114, 113). RGB Color Model of #557271 consists of 33% red, 44% green and 44% blue. HSL color Mode of #557271 has 178°(degrees) Hue, 15% Saturation and 39% Lightness. #557271 color has an wavelength of 507.92593n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#557271 is #669999.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#557271 is #577. The Closest Color to #557271 is #696969. Official Name of #557271 Hex Code is Cutty Sark.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#557271 is 25 Cyan 0 Magenta 1 Yellow 55 Black and #557271 CMY is 25, 0, 1.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#557271 is hsl(178,15,39,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(178, 25,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#557271 is 12.74, 15.16, 17.87.
Hex8 Value of #557271 is #557271FF. Decimal Value of #557271 is 5599857 and Octal Value of #557271 is 25271161. Binary Value of #557271 is 1010101, 1110010, 1110001 and Android of #557271 is 4283789937 / 0xff557271.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#557271 is 0.278, 0.331, 0.331 and YIQ Color Space of #557271 is 105.215, -16.9598, -6.4447.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#557271 is 12.95, 16.88, 17.82.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#557271 is 45.85, -10.72, -2.86.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#557271 is 45.85, -14.52, -2.31.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#557271 is 45.85, 11.09, 194.94. Hunter Lab variable of #557271 is 38.94, -9.73, 0.04.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#557271

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
